Traditionally, women have waited for their besotted lover, boyfriend, or husband to indulge them in a piece of jewellery. but these days, there is an emerging trend—that of the self-purchasing woman or SPW. “We are seeing dramatically increasing numbers of women buying their own jewellery with or without gemstones,” says andrea Hopson, vice-president of Tiffany & Co., Canada.
